Tongwei, Jinko, and 10 other companies were pre-selected for the 1GW module centralised procurement order of the South-to-North Water Diversion Project.

Published: Apr 3, 2025 11:29
On April 2, the list of successful candidates for the 2025-2026 concentrated procurement of PV modules by the South-to-North Water Diversion Middle Route New Energy (Beijing) Co., Ltd. was announced. The selected companies included Tongwei Co., Ltd., Jinko Solar Co., Ltd., LONGi Green Energy Technology Co., Ltd., JA Solar Technology Co., Ltd., DAS Solar Co., Ltd., Chint New Energy Technology Co., Ltd., TrinaSolar Co., Ltd., Risen Energy Co., Ltd., AIKO Solar Technology Co., Ltd., Anhui Huasheng New Energy Technology Co., Ltd., Anhui Guosheng New Energy Technology Co., Ltd., and Gokin Solar Co., Ltd.

The average winning bid price for Section 1 was 0.6998 yuan/W, and for Section 2, it was 0.76 yuan/W. The tender announcement indicated that this concentrated procurement was divided into two sections. Section 1 was for N-type monocrystalline double-glass (TOPCon) PV modules, and Section 2 was for monocrystalline double-glass (BC/HJT) PV modules. The total planned capacity was 1,000 MW. Section 1: N-type monocrystalline double-glass (TOPCon) PV modules, with a planned procurement capacity of 700 MW, including models with a conversion efficiency of 22.5% and above. Section 2: Monocrystalline double-glass (BC/HJT) PV modules, with a planned procurement capacity of 300 MW, including models with a conversion efficiency of 22.85% and above.

China Approves 17.44 GW Power Plan for Qaidam Desert Base, Including Solar, Wind, and Energy Storage Projects
It is understood that the National Energy Administration has officially approved the power source allocation plan for the "Qaidam Desert Base (East Golmud) Base". The planned construction scale of the power source projects at this base is 17.44 million kilowatts, including 10 million kilowatts of photovoltaic power, 5 million kilowatts of wind power, 2.64 million kilowatts of coal-fired power, 0.1 million kilowatts of solar thermal power, and 1.5 million kilowatts (for 4 hours) of electrochemical energy storage. The total investment in the projects is about 86 billion yuan. The new energy will be transmitted to Guangxi through the "Qinghai-Guangxi DC" UHV power transmission project. [SMM PV News] Armenia Hits 1.1 GW Solar Capacity,
Armenia’s cumulative solar capacity has surged to 1.1 GW following the addition of approximately 615 MW in 2025. This rapid expansion has pushed solar's share of electricity generation to around 15%, effectively meeting the country's 2030 target years ahead of schedule. The growth is heavily driven by a net-metering scheme supporting over 50,000 autonomous producers (totaling 650 MW), though the government ended loan subsidies for rooftop solar in July to shift focus toward battery storage.
